The keywords meta tag is useless

Why the Keywords Meta tag is totally and utterly useless.

There was a time where webmasters where to set the keywords of their websites, using a certain keywords tag. This was however abused by a lot of webmasters, to spam the SERPs, so search engines started to ignore it entirely, as an example to follow.

The keywords meta tag has little use today, and is practically worthless. Today search engines use other much more precise methods, to determine the relevancy of websites.

Abused for spam

Search engines has become very sophisticated in analyzing content of web pages, which means that it has become very difficult, to get a decent ranking keywords unrelated to your pages.

There was a time where some webmasters, would simply fill the keywords tag, with a bunch of unrelated keywords, in a pony attempt to drive more traffic to their sites.

Other abusable tags

There are arguably other tags which can be abused, but not nearly as easily without getting spotted, and abusing those may servilely harm the placement of a website. Then you might ask, well why not just compare the content of the keywords tag with the content of the page? Well its more efficient to simply analyze the content alone, since it obviously needs to be checked anyway.
